Wedbush Securities Managing Director of Equity Research David Chiaverini joined Market Domination to provide insights into the fintech landscape. Chiaverini observed that buy now, pay later (BNPL) transactions currently represent "a very small share" of overall retail sales. However, he highlighted that these platforms are growing faster than overall sales, leading him to conclude that "the outlook for BNPL providers is favorable here." Analyzing specific companies, Chiaverini discussed Affirm (AFRM). While expressing concern about the company's valuation at 8x earnings, he noted that the fundamentals are trending positively, with continued growth and improved credit quality. Turning to SoFi (SOFI), which he currently rates as underperform, Chiaverini acknowledged the company's successful positioning in this year's fintech rebound.
